Item 8.01 Other Events

Par Pharmaceutical Companies, Inc. (the “Company”) caused to be delivered to the holders of the Company’s 7 38% Senior Notes Due 2020 (the “Notes”) a conditional notice of redemption relating to the full redemption of all issued and outstanding Notes in an aggregate principal amount of $490,000,000.00 (the “Redemption”) on September 30, 2015 (the “Redemption Date”), pursuant to Section 5(a) of the Notes and Section 3.07(a) of the Indenture, dated as of September 28, 2012 (as amended, supplemented or otherwise modified to date, the “Indenture”), among Sky Growth Acquisition Corporation, predecessor in interest to the Company, and Wells Fargo Bank, National Association, a national banking association, as trustee (the “Trustee”). The redemption price for the Notes is equal to the sum of 100.0% of the principal amount of the Notes plus the Applicable Premium (as defined in the Indenture) as of the Redemption Date plus accrued and unpaid interest on the Notes up to, but excluding, the Redemption Date (the “Redemption Price”).

The Company’s obligation to pay the Redemption Price on the Redemption Date is conditioned upon (i) the Closing, as defined in that certain Agreement and Plan of Merger, dated as of May 18, 2015 (the “Merger Agreement”) by and among the Company’s indirect parent company, Par Pharmaceutical Holdings, Inc., a Delaware corporation (the “Parent”), Endo International plc, a public limited company incorporated under the laws of Ireland (the “Acquiror”), Endo Designated Activity Company (f/k/a Endo Limited), a private limited company incorporated under the laws of Ireland, Endo Health Solutions Inc., a Delaware corporation, Hawk Acquisition Ireland Limited (f/k/a Banyuls Limited), a private limited company incorporated under the laws of Ireland, Hawk Acquisition ULC, a Bermudian unlimited liability company and Shareholder Representative Services LLC, a Colorado limited liability company, solely in its capacity as the Stakeholder Representative (as defined therein) on or before September 30, 2015 (the “Merger Condition”), (ii) the delivery of written notice to the Trustee by the Company stating (a) that the Merger Condition has been satisfied and (b) the amount of the Redemption Price (the “Notice Condition”) and (iii) a representative of the bond redemption committee, appointed by the board of directors of Parent, has not delivered a written notice to the Trustee stating that it does not expect the Merger Condition to be satisfied (the “Committee Condition”, and, together with the Merger Condition and the Notice Condition, the “Conditions”). In its sole discretion, the Company may waive all or any of the Conditions.
